HC Deb 01 May 1995 vol 259 c107W
24. Mr. Peter Bottomley

To ask the Secretary of State for Social Security if he will propose that child benefits should be renamed child cash allowances, that the cost should be deducted in national accounts from taxes received by the Exchequer and that the levels should be decided by the Chancellor in common with personal tax allowances. [20143]

Mr. Burt

No. Child benefit is proper to this Department's vote and will continue to be treated in national accounts in the same way as all other social security benefits.
